Is Ghee Good for Weight Loss? (Science + Ayurveda)

Traditional Indian ghee prepared from cow milk for healthy and sustainable weight loss.

Ghee is made up of healthy fats, particularly short-chain and medium-chain fatty acids, which the body can digest and convert to energy easily. It also has CLA (Conjugated Linoleic Acid), which is a known fat reducer and metabolism enhancer. According to Ayurveda, ghee helps in strengthening Agni (digestive fire). A healthy digestive system facilitates nutrient absorption and makes fat accumulation difficult. Hence the reason traditional Indian diets always had traditional Indian ghee as a daily staple. The myth "ghee makes you fat" is a consequence of overconsumption and low-quality products usage. Pure cow ghee, if eaten moderately, is a metabolism booster and not a weight-gain food.

How Ghee Helps in Faster Weight Loss

Boosts Metabolism Naturally

The good fats in ghee turn on fat-burning hormones and energize the body in a better way.

Improves Digestion & Gut Health

Ghee is good for the gut lining; it helps the gut by decreasing inflammation and getting better digestion. These are the main factors for weight loss in a healthy way.

Keeps You Full for Longer

When ghee is included in the diet, it increases satiety, and therefore less snacking and sugar cravings will happen.

Supports Hormonal Balance

Hormone balance is very important for weight control, especially for female hormones. Ghee supplies fat-soluble vitamins that help this equilibrium.

Helps Burn Stubborn Fat

Pure cow ghee, combined with a balanced diet, is a great way for the body to release fat that is stored.

How Much Ghee Should You Eat Per Day?

The right amount is 1 teaspoon per day for most people.

As the saying goes, one spoon ghee is enough to enjoy all the benefits without excess calories.

Sedentary lifestyle: 1 teaspoon Active
lifestyle: Up to 2 teaspoons

Moderation is key more ghee does not mean faster weight loss.

Ghee vs. Other Fats for Weight Loss

Ghee retains its stability even when cooked at high temperatures and is free of any harmful trans fats unlike refined oils and butter. Hence, healthy ghee for Indian families would be an ideal solution to be left with fewer cooking oils.
